Retrieve the Current WorkspaceID in a Dataflow

Hi,

 

I have a dataflow which should work with the same code in various different workspaces. Each workspace relates to a different customer and the data being processed change for each customer. So far I use a parameter in the dataflow for each Workspace. But I have to change this parameter manually. When I update the code of the dataflow, I need to copy and paste the new code into the dataflow, which overrides the parameter as well, so I have to change the parameter again. 

 

Is there a way to make this dynamically, e.g. that I would fetch the current URL aka WorkspaceID in PowerQuery, which I can then link to the customer through a mapping table. Something linke Current.Website or Current.Workspace? 

 

Any ideas?


Many Thanks.
